First Collection: 2006–2009 is a compilation album by Fleet Foxes that encompasses the band's early works, including their self-titled EP and debut album, 'Fleet Foxes'. The album showcases their signature harmonies and folk-infused sound, which combines elements of baroque pop and traditional folk music. This collection highlights the band's lyrical depth and intricate arrangements, solidifying their place in the indie folk revival of the late 2000s.
